Transaction 5b63ed878fc52ced701de76d26274f26c047637de722e34cdde9efe1b4e1f996
1 Input
2 Outputs
- 5b63ed878fc52ced701de76d26274f26c047637de722e34cdde9efe1b4e1f996:0
- 5b63ed878fc52ced701de76d26274f26c047637de722e34cdde9efe1b4e1f996:1
value 281760
address 3NTYGuaha3G2jnuLudKW43RcGR3zjeNECo
value 599706
address 14XjQH8CTkyMvWgEuJHYbkaJLpAo73yvp6